The San Francisco 49ers are playing the Los Angeles Rams at Levi's Stadium in Santa Clara, California. The Niners entered the matchup without running back
Tyrion Davis-Price (ankle), wide receiver
Danny Gray (hip), defensive tackle
Javon Kinlaw (knee), tight end Tyler Kroft (knee), defensive back Tarvarius Moore (hamstring), and tackle
Trent Williams (ankle). They were among the
49ers' seven inactive players in Week 4.
Below are the 49ers-Rams in-game injury updates.
OL Colton McKivitz (knee, out)
In the third quarter, the 49ers ruled out offensive lineman
Colton McKivitz with a knee injury. McKivitz was filling in for left tackle Trent Williams, who suffered a high-ankle sprain in Week 3 against the Denver Broncos.
Jaylon Moore entered the game for McKivitz following the injury.
DL Arik Armstead (foot, out)
In the fourth quarter, the 49ers announced that defensive lineman
Arik Armstead is ruled out of the remainder of the game due to a foot injury. Armstead missed the team's Week 3 contest against the Denver Broncos due to plantar fasciitis in his right foot.
